The traditional research process, often characterized by sifting through vast libraries and databases, is being revolutionized by AI. Tools can now rapidly analyze massive datasets, identify patterns, and even suggest relevant scholarly articles that a student might have otherwise missed. For a student at a US university, this means being able to delve into complex topics with greater efficiency and depth. For instance, AI can help in identifying emerging trends in fields like environmental science or public health, crucial for students working on capstone projects or theses. Imagine a history student researching the impact of the New Deal; AI could quickly surface lesser-known primary sources or connect disparate academic arguments, providing a more nuanced understanding. A practical tip for students is to use AI to generate initial literature reviews or to identify keywords for more targeted searches, saving valuable time for critical analysis and synthesis. While concerns about academic integrity persist, AI tools offer legitimate avenues for improving writing quality and fostering critical thinking. AI-powered grammar checkers and style editors can help students refine their prose, ensuring clarity and conciseness, which is vital in academic writing across all disciplines. Beyond simple error correction, some AI can provide feedback on argumentation, structure, and even suggest alternative phrasing to strengthen a point. For a student in a US literature class, AI might help identify thematic connections across different texts or suggest ways to articulate complex literary analysis. For a business major, AI could assist in structuring a persuasive case study or refining the executive summary of a business plan. The key is to use these tools as a collaborative partner, not a replacement for original thought. Students should focus on using AI to identify areas for improvement and then apply their own critical judgment to implement changes, thereby deepening their understanding of effective communication. For example, instead of asking AI to write an essay, a student could ask it to critique a draft for logical fallacies or to suggest ways to improve the flow between paragraphs. The rapid adoption of AI in academic settings necessitates a robust understanding of ethical guidelines and responsible usage. Universities across the United States are actively developing policies to address the use of AI in assignments, emphasizing originality and academic integrity. Students must be aware that submitting AI-generated content as their own work constitutes plagiarism. The ethical use of AI involves leveraging it for tasks such as brainstorming, outlining, summarizing complex information, or refining drafts, while ensuring that the final product reflects the student’s own understanding and critical engagement with the material. For example, a computer science student might use AI to debug code, but they are still responsible for understanding the logic and functionality of the corrected code. Similarly, a political science student might use AI to analyze public opinion data, but they must interpret the findings and draw their own conclusions. A crucial aspect is transparency; if AI assistance significantly contributed to a project, students should be prepared to discuss their process.
